Abstract

The utility model discloses a high-temperature-resistant flexible cable for locomotives, which belongs to the technical field of locomotive flexible cables and is characterized by comprising a cable main body, wherein the cable main body comprises a surface sheath layer, an isolation layer is arranged on the inner wall of the surface sheath layer, a high-temperature-resistant layer is arranged on the inner wall of the isolation layer, mineral substance wrapping belts are arranged on the inner wall of the high-temperature-resistant layer, a plurality of stranded conductors are arranged in the mineral substance wrapping belts, and a mineral substance insulating layer is arranged on the surface of each stranded conductor; the high-temperature-resistant layer comprises an inner bottom layer, so that the problems that when the conventional flexible cable used as locomotive equipment is used, the high-temperature-resistant performance of the conventional flexible cable is poor, and because some locomotive equipment is used in a high-temperature environment, the flexible cable matched with the conventional flexible cable cannot be normally used in the high-temperature environment, the service performance of the conventional flexible cable is poor, and the use effect is affected are solved.

Referring to fig. 1-3, the present utility model provides the following technical solutions: the flexible cable for the locomotive with high temperature resistance comprises a cable main body 1, wherein the cable main body 1 comprises a surface sheath layer 2, an isolation layer 3 is arranged on the inner wall of the surface sheath layer 2, a high temperature resistant layer 4 is arranged on the inner wall of the isolation layer 3, a mineral wrapping belt 5 is arranged on the inner wall of the high temperature resistant layer 4, a plurality of stranded conductors 6 are arranged in the mineral wrapping belt 5, and a mineral insulating layer 7 is arranged on the surface of the stranded conductors 6; the high temperature resistant layer 4 includes interior bottom 401, interior bottom 401 sets up the surface at mineral substance band 5, the surface of interior bottom 401 is provided with middle enhancement layer 402, the surface of middle enhancement layer 402 is provided with surface insulation layer 403, through setting up surperficial restrictive coating 2, can reach the effect of reinforcing cable main part 1 fire resistance, make it be difficult for taking place the burning, and through setting up isolation layer 3, can use with surperficial restrictive coating 2 cooperation, further reinforcing cable main part 1's fire resistance, thereby the normal use of cable main part 1 has been ensured, and through setting up high temperature resistant layer 4, under the cooperation use of interior bottom 401, middle enhancement layer 402 and surface insulation layer 403, can play the high temperature resistant ability of promotion cable main part 1, and to the isolated effect of external high temperature, make external high temperature be difficult for corroding in cable main part 1, consequently, make it be difficult for damaging because of the high temperature, the reliability of locomotive equipment use has been guaranteed.
The surface sheath layer 2 is made of polyolefin material and is extruded on the surface of the isolation layer 3, and the effect of enhancing the flame retardant property of the cable main body 1 can be achieved through the surface sheath layer 2 made of polyolefin material, so that the cable main body 1 is not easy to burn;
the isolating layer 3 is a magnesium oxide coating and is uniformly coated on the surface of the high temperature resistant layer 4, and the isolating layer 3 is a magnesium oxide coating and is uniformly coated on the surface of the high temperature resistant layer 4, so that the isolating layer can be matched with the surface sheath layer 2 for use, the fireproof performance of the cable main body 1 is further enhanced, and the normal use of the cable main body 1 is ensured;
the inner bottom layer 401 is an ethylene propylene rubber sleeve and is extruded on the surface of the mineral wrapping belt 5, and the inner bottom layer 401 is an ethylene propylene rubber sleeve and is extruded on the surface of the mineral wrapping belt 5, so that the high temperature resistance of the cable main body 1 can be improved, the external high temperature is not easy to erode into the cable main body 1, and the cable main body is not easy to damage due to high temperature;
the middle reinforcing layer 402 is a silicone rubber sleeve and is extruded on the surface of the inner bottom layer 401, and the effect of further enhancing the high temperature resistance of the cable main body 1 can be achieved by the fact that the middle reinforcing layer 402 is a silicone rubber sleeve and is extruded on the surface of the inner bottom layer 401, so that the usability of the cable main body 1 in a high temperature environment is ensured;
the surface insulating layer 403 is a mica tape and is wrapped on the surface of the middle reinforcing layer 402, and the surface insulating layer 403 formed by the mica tape can play a role in insulating the outside from high temperature, so that the outside high temperature is not easy to erode into the cable main body 1, and therefore the cable main body is not easy to damage due to high temperature, and the reliability of the cable main body as locomotive equipment is ensured;
the inside of mineral substance band 5 is filled with mineral substance filler 8, and is close to one side and the mineral substance insulating layer 7 contact of mineral substance insulating layer 7, through filling mineral substance filler 8 in the inside of mineral substance band 5, can reach the effect that promotes cable main part 1 service strength, makes it not fragile to guaranteed life.
Working principle: firstly, through setting up surperficial restrictive coating 2, can reach the effect of reinforcing cable main part 1 fire resistance, make it be difficult for taking place to burn, and through the isolation layer 3 of setting up, can use with surperficial restrictive coating 2 cooperation, further reinforcing cable main part 1's fire behavior, thereby guaranteed the normal use of cable main part 1, and through setting up high temperature resistant layer 4, under the cooperation use of bottom 401, middle enhancement layer 402 and surface insulation layer 403, can play promotion cable main part 1 high temperature resistant ability, and to the isolated effect of external high temperature, make external high temperature difficult to erode in the cable main part 1, consequently make it be difficult for damaging because of the high temperature, the reliability of using as locomotive equipment has been guaranteed.
